General Fiasco at Barfly London
Overview
After a successful performance at Northern Ireland's unsigned music festival, Glasgowbury, this indie band from Magherafelt have gone on to support The Enemy, The Wombats and The Pigeon Detectives. Renowned for being edgier than their lightweight indie peers, General Fiasco have a growing fanbase due to their energetic live performances and singles such as ‘Rebel Get By' and 'Something Sometime'. The band crucially supported Snow Patrol on their homecoming Ward Park gig in Bangor in June 2010. While welcoming the exposure in Garry Lightbody's back garden, the Irish lads are ready to go it alone and will be headlining their own shows from now on.
